自动化专业用什么编程软件
-
自动化专业使用的编程软件主要有以下几种:
-
MATLAB(Matrix Laboratory):MATLAB是一种高级编程语言和环境,被广泛用于科学计算、数据分析和工程建模。在自动化领域,MATLAB被用于控制系统设计、信号处理、图像处理和机器学习等方面。
-
LabVIEW(Laboratory Virtual Instrument Engineering Workbench):LabVIEW是一种图形化编程语言,用于开发控制和测量系统。它提供了丰富的函数库和工具箱,用于各种自动化应用,包括仪器控制、数据采集和实时控制等。
-
PLC编程软件(Programmable Logic Controller):PLC是一种用于控制工业过程的可编程控制器。PLC编程软件通常是供特定品牌或型号的PLC使用的,如Siemens的STEP 7、Rockwell的RSLogix和Schneider Electric的Unity Pro等。
-
Python:Python是一种通用的高级编程语言,具有简单易学、代码可读性高的特点。在自动化领域,Python常用于数据分析、机器学习和人工智能等方面,同时也可以用于控制系统开发。
-
C/C++:C和C++是传统的编程语言,被广泛应用于嵌入式系统和实时控制领域。在自动化专业中,C/C++常用于编写底层驱动程序和实时控制算法。
以上是自动化专业常用的编程软件,选择使用哪种软件主要取决于具体的应用需求和个人偏好。
1年前 -
-
自动化专业使用的编程软件有以下几种:
-
MATLAB:MATLAB是一种高级的数学计算和编程环境,广泛用于工程和科学领域。它提供了丰富的工具箱,可以用于数据分析、信号处理、控制系统设计等各种自动化任务。
-
LabVIEW:LabVIEW是一种图形化编程环境,特别适用于控制系统的设计和实现。它通过拖放图形化的图标来构建程序,使得编程变得更加直观和易于理解。
-
Python:Python是一种通用的编程语言,也是自动化专业常用的编程工具之一。它具有简洁明了的语法和丰富的库支持,可以用于各种自动化任务的开发和实现。
-
C/C++:C/C++是一种常用的编程语言,也广泛应用于自动化专业。它具有高效的执行速度和灵活的编程能力,适合于需要高性能和实时性的自动化任务。
-
PLC编程软件:PLC(可编程逻辑控制器)是自动化系统中常用的硬件设备,用于控制和监控各种工业过程。PLC编程软件可以用于编写和调试PLC程序,实现对自动化系统的控制和管理。
这些编程软件各有特点,选择使用哪种软件取决于具体的自动化任务和个人的编程习惯。在自动化专业中,通常会根据具体需求选择合适的编程软件,以实现自动化系统的设计、开发和控制。
1年前 -
-
自动化专业主要涉及到控制系统、机器人、工业自动化等领域,因此在编程方面需要使用一些特定的软件来进行开发和控制。以下是几种常见的自动化编程软件:
-
PLC编程软件:PLC(Programmable Logic Controller,可编程逻辑控制器)是工业自动化中常用的控制器,其编程软件主要包括Siemens STEP 7、Rockwell RSLogix、Schneider Unity Pro等。这些软件提供了图形化编程界面,可以通过拖拽连接元件和逻辑块来实现控制程序的开发。
-
SCADA编程软件:SCADA(Supervisory Control And Data Acquisition,监控与数据采集)用于实时监控和控制工业过程。常见的SCADA软件包括Wonderware InTouch、Siemens WinCC、GE iFix等。这些软件提供了图形化界面,用于创建人机界面,并与PLC或其他控制设备进行通信。
-
机器人编程软件:机器人编程软件用于控制和编程工业机器人。常见的机器人编程软件包括ABB RobotStudio、KUKA Sim Pro、Fanuc Roboguide等。这些软件提供了图形化界面,可以模拟机器人动作、创建程序、调试和优化机器人运动路径。
-
MATLAB/Simulink:MATLAB是一种高级的计算和数学建模软件,Simulink是MATLAB的一个附加模块,用于系统建模、仿真和控制设计。MATLAB/Simulink在自动化专业中广泛应用于控制算法设计、系统仿真和数据处理等方面。
-
LabVIEW:LabVIEW是一种基于图形化编程的开发环境,主要用于测量与自动化领域。LabVIEW提供了丰富的控制与数据采集函数库,可用于开发各种自动化应用,如仪器控制、数据采集与处理、实时控制等。
除了上述软件,还有许多其他的自动化编程软件可根据具体应用领域选择使用。不同的软件具有不同的特点和功能,根据实际需求选择适合的编程软件是非常重要的。
1年前 -